Conditions

Postoperative depression

Interventions

Control group:The patient was given 0.3 mg/kg normal saline
Experimental group:Intravenous injection of 0.3 mg/kg esketamine

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Age =60 years old; ASA grade I~III; Elderly patients undergoing knee replacement at selected time; Male SMI < 42.6cm2/m2 Female SMI < 30.6cm2/m2.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: A history of malignant hyperthermia; Esketamine has contraindication; Patients with a history of severe mental illness, long-term use of antidepressants; BMI > 30kg/m2; Disturbance of consciousness, inability to complete the scale

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Hamilton scale score;NLRP3 Inflammatory factor;IL-6;Plasma ceramide;
